Neural Sciences establishes the neuroscientific framework underlying psychiatric theory and practice by examining how biological systems generate behavior and mental experience. The chapter emphasizes that understanding psychiatric disorders requires integration of molecular, cellular, systems-level, and behavioral perspectives, moving beyond purely descriptive diagnostic approaches toward mechanistic explanations grounded in neurobiology. Modern neuroimaging techniques have enabled researchers to visualize brain activity and structure in living patients, revealing neural circuit abnormalities associated with various psychiatric conditions and providing objective markers for understanding disease pathophysiology. Advances in psychiatric genetics, particularly the discovery of rare genetic variants through large-scale genome sequencing initiatives, have illuminated molecular mechanisms contributing to mental illness and opened new avenues for targeted therapeutic development. Revolutionary laboratory techniques including optogenetics, which allows precise temporal control of neuronal activity using light, and DREADDs technology, enabling selective manipulation of specific neural populations, have dramatically accelerated mechanistic research in neuroscience. Gene editing approaches such as CRISPR have further transformed the landscape by permitting direct modification of disease-associated genetic sequences in experimental models. The chapter positions psychiatry at an inflection point where emerging technologies and expanding biological knowledge are enabling the field to transition from symptom-based classification toward biologically informed understanding of mental disorders. By integrating findings across genetics, molecular neurobiology, neural circuit analysis, and translational research, this introduction demonstrates how contemporary neuroscience provides the foundation for developing more effective diagnostic strategies and evidence-based treatments, ultimately reshaping psychiatric practice in coming decades.
